The High Elves



In the beginning

High Elves was the race that advanced quicker than all the other races combined. They were using magic by the time most of the other races had just started using primitive tools. As a result, the first High Elven fortresses that were built were considered as the houses of Gods by the other races, harsh and cruel Gods that is, since the High Elves used all the other races as slaves for their own means.

However harsh and cruel was the reign of the High Elves, their kingdoms and their expansions combined with the use of the local people of each area, are the basis for the civilization that is spread across the land and the various society structures. Many scholars believe that if not for the High Elves, most races will still be living as hunters and gatherers.

Society

The society of the High Elves has changed during the Eons. While they started like a warring race, conquering and exploring the land (and in the process spreading technology and civilization), the continuous use of magic and their reliance to it, made the magic users really powerful. The most powerful magic users announced themselves God-Kings (so advanced was their mastery of magic) and started waging war on each other. Since the death of a High Elf is considered a very serious and sad event, mercenaries and slaves were used for the civil wars while the former Elven warriors became artisans, scholars, merchants or pompous aristocrats caring only for their well being.

The civil wars continued for ages with no clear winner but huge casualties on the other races. In the mean time, the Elves of Ravenwood were formed by various Elven refugees who were opposed to the High Elven oppression against all the other races and were against the continuous use of magic.

Whatever the cost to the other races, the High Elven expertise of magic grew even bigger. However, they grew more dependent on it, even for performing menial tasks. This resulted in the Orcish rebellion and the final downfall of the Elven Kingdoms.

View to the World

When the Orcish rebellion came, it forced the High Elves to retreat to the West and change their politics and their usual practices. They used to be powerful but now they are trying to survive against almost all.

After the Orcish rebellion, the High Elves are ruled now by Vasil Zitrious, the only Mage-King that understood that the High Elves were near the brink of destruction and decided to withdraw his forces away from the Orcish Empire

He managed to do this with the help of the Men of Hawkshold, whose trust he gains after virtually offering them everything; knowledge, technology and even a new ruler, raised by him with High Elven ideals. This alliance stands up to now, with only some minor conflicts between the humans and some young Elven princes, trying to prove that the High Elves can return back to their former glory.

The alliance with the Men of Hawkshold is very important because it provides the only way to the inner sea for the High Elves, the only way to the biggest merchant centers  of the world.

The Army

The High Elves are gifted by nature itself. Tall, agile and strong, they excel in hand to hand and ranged combat. Their limited numbers are offset with high maneuverability and a strict army training that has gone on for centuries and as a result of this, High Elves deploy the most disciplined army that has ever seen the field of battle. Their prowess is further enhanced by their use of magic (battle mages and magic swords) and magical armor.

Celestial Guard When you are attacked by the Celestial Guard, you think that the offspring of the God of War have landed on our world and decided to kill you. Their grace is dwarfed by their viciousness and their frightening effectiveness in killing any opposition thrown to them. They are thought to be immortal and invincible across the whole world and a lot of myths surround their name and their deeds. Probably the best fighting foot unit that has ever existed on this world.

Chariots and bow riders
After the orcish rebellion, the doctrine of the High Elven army had to change rapidly. The main concern was now mobility and not sheer numbers, thus the emergence of the chariot as a core unit and the bow riders as a unit to harass the enemy without the risk of melee. However fragile the chariots, the High Elves continue their research on them and try to use them in as many roles as possible, either as transporters for troops or shock troops to quickly dispatch units that have become shaken after missile fire.

Scorpions Continuing the idea of mobility and firepower, with the help of magic and mithril, the scorpions were borne. More mobile and easier to assemble than a ballista or a catapult, scorpions provide the firepower need to stop the heavy armored units and monster favored by their main enemy, the Orcish Empire.
